人工智能(AI)是计算机科学的一个分支,它试图理解和构建智能的系统,使机器能够执行通常需要人类智能才能完成的任务,如语音识别、决策制定、视觉感知等。近年来,随着技术的不断进步,人工智能在各个领域的应用越来越广泛,其核心要素也在不断地发展和完善。
1. 数据:人工智能的基础是数据。无论是机器学习还是深度学习,都需要大量的数据作为训练样本。数据的质量和数量直接影响到人工智能的性能。因此,如何收集、整理和处理数据,是人工智能研究和应用中的一个重要问题。
2. 算法:算法是实现人工智能的关键。不同的算法适用于解决不同类型的问题。例如,决策树算法适用于分类问题,神经网络算法适用于回归问题等。因此,如何选择和设计合适的算法,是实现人工智能的关键。
3. 计算能力:随着人工智能应用的深入,对计算能力的需求也越来越高。传统的CPU和GPU已经无法满足大规模并行计算的需求,因此,高性能的专用硬件,如GPU、TPU等,成为了人工智能研究和应用的重要方向。
4. 模型训练:人工智能的训练过程是一个复杂的迭代过程,需要大量的计算资源。因此,如何优化模型训练过程,提高训练效率,是实现人工智能的关键。
5. 可解释性:虽然人工智能在许多领域取得了显著的成果,但是其决策过程往往是黑箱操作,缺乏可解释性。因此,如何提高人工智能的可解释性,使其能够被人类理解和信任,是实现人工智能的关键。
6. 伦理和法律:随着人工智能技术的发展,其应用范围也越来越广,涉及到许多伦理和法律问题。例如,人工智能是否会取代人类的工作?人工智能是否应该拥有权利?这些问题都需要我们进行深入的思考和探讨。
总的来说,人工智能的核心要素包括数据、算法、计算能力、模型训练、可解释性和伦理法律等。这些要素相互影响,共同推动着人工智能的发展。在未来,我们期待人工智能能够在更多的领域发挥其优势,为人类社会带来更多的便利和进步。